2025 African Political Leader Award: Patrice Talon finalist

Benin’s President Patrice Talon is among the four finalists for African Political Leader of the Year 2025.

This award, presented by African Leadership Magazine (ALM), highlights career paths that strengthen governance and accelerate development across the continent. The shortlist has attracted significant attention from the African public and underscores growing interest in credible leadership models.

Alongside Patrice Talon are Namibian President Netumbo Nandi-Ndaitwah, recently re-elected, Cape Verdean President José Maria Neves and Botswana leader Duma Gideon Boko.

These leaders come from different political backgrounds but share a common commitment to the stability, growth and modernization of their countries.

ALM’s editorial committee selected the finalists following a rigorous process of nominations submitted from across the continent and its diaspora. The public can vote until 30 November 2025 on the magazine’s official website.

The winner will be celebrated at the fifteenth edition of the African Leadership Magazine Persons of the Year (POTY), scheduled in Accra, Ghana, on 27 and 28 February 2026. The event will be held under the theme “Leadership for a new Africa: forging our peace and owning our narrative”.

POTY highlights African leaders and public figures whose actions are transforming governance, the economy and social life. The award isn’t limited to heads of state.

Several categories are planned to distinguish key figures from major sectors. They include African Female Leader of the Year, African Educator of the Year, African Leader for Peace and Security, African Industrialist of the Year, African Philanthropist of the Year, African Young Leader of the Year, African Public Sector Leader, African Champion of Public Health, African Leader in Agricultural Development, African Minister of the Year and African Politician of the Year.

The fifteenth edition will bring together presidents, ministers, business leaders and innovators from across Africa. ALM will thus consolidate its role as a reference platform to showcase initiatives shaping the continent’s future.

This nomination also gives African citizens a chance to get involved directly by public vote, a way to express the expectations of a continent seeking credible leadership, innovation and concrete results.
